Haunted With the start of spring, a spate of ghost stories appeared in the UK national media. The first – headlined “Diana Ghost has the Royals by the Ghoulies” – appeared in the Daily Star (22 March 2006), and seemed to suggest that the shade of Diana, Princess of Wales, was haunting Prince Charles and the Duchess of Cornwall, claiming the “dead princess’s spirit is spooking their every step on a trip to Egypt”. Closer examination revealed this to be journalistic whimsy and a rare foray into metaphor by the tabloid. Nowhere in the article was a spontaneous manifestation actually mentioned as having taken place.
